The forex (foreign exchange) market is often considered the largest and most fluid market you can find, with more than $7.5 trillion traded in forex every day. That is why traders and brokers are eager to be involved with this fast-paced market and allow their users to efficiently, securely, and in real-time transact with liquid currencies on innovative digital platforms.
Developing a website from scratch can be both expensive and time-intensive. Forex Trading Script is an inexpensive and customizable off-the-shelf software tool to help your business implement a professional forex trading platform quickly and efficiently.
What is a Forex Trading Script?
A Forex Trading Script is a white-labeled, pre-built software solution that empowers businesses to begin a forex trading platform, hosting core trading, security, and management features. The script is intended to allow users to trade in various currencies, is accessible from anywhere in the world, provides up-to-date and accurate exchange rates, supports and administers user accounts, has instant trade execution, and complies with local laws.
The script supports the basic functions of trade that users can experience while using other platforms such as MetaTrader, cTrader, or Forex.com. It allows customers to endure an environment that is familiar to them as traders, while businesses can brand, modify for trading pairs, adjust commission structures, and meet business practices.
Features of a Forex Trading Script
-
Multi-Currency Support
The script has a multi-currency functional capability, allowing trading to happen in many fiat currencies, including the USD, EUR, GBP, and JPY. This allows traders anywhere in the world to have access to trade. This framework provides real-time conversions and liquidity between trading pairs so traders can trade seamlessly.
-
Live Market Data
The platform incorporates live market feeds and price charts so that traders can have real-time data for pricing to make intelligent trading decisions. It also provides automated pricing analytics so that users can examine and evaluate trends, price movements, and trading volume.
-
Order execution
The script allows for the various order types that users can trade, including market, limit, stop loss, and take profit orders. All traders can navigate the user-friendly dashboard of the platform, manage their portfolio, see performance, and make trades.
-
Liquidity Provider Integration
Integration with leading liquidity providers means that execution of trades can happen instantaneously with minimal slippage. This means the script will ensure that traders have a reliable execution experience and is perfect for high-frequency traders.
-
Automated Trading (bots)
The platform supports AI or Expert Advisors (EAs) to automate trading based on intelligent trading setups that are pre-defined by the trader. This means the trader can take advantage of trading opportunities around the clock without trading manually.
-
User & Admin Dashboards
Each trader navigates the intuitive dashboard of the platform to manage their portfolio, view performance, and execute trades. The platform allows its Admins to manage and review trading transactions, create & manage commissions, and fairly resolve any disputes that may arise.
-
Reporting and Analytics
The script gives users the ability to construct reports that are comprehensive and provide details on trading activity, profits, losses, and user activity. This insight is valuable for brokers and traders to improve process strategies and maintain a transparent relationship with clients.
-
Payment Gateway Integration
Numerous payment methods (i.e., bank transfer, cards, and crypto gateways) enable easy deposit and withdrawal processes for traders, allowing for a seamless financial, trading, and overall behavioral experience for traders from anywhere in the world.
Benefits of a Forex Trading Script
-
Faster Launch to Market
With a pre-built forex script, it can eliminate the build time of your platform, which allows businesses to go live in weeks versus months. This can provide businesses with a faster inception and accomplishment in a competitive marketplace.
-
Cost-Effective Approach
The pre-built forex script cuts out costs associated with the process of building a platform, all while upholding enterprise-grade quality. This provides businesses the ability to use the time previously used for the technical build, execution, and support processes to spend back into branding and operation processes.
-
Scalable Infrastructure
The architecture can run multiple concurrent trades at the same time and maintain operational performance. As users and activity increase, you will be capable of ramping up resources and features.
-
User-Focused Interface
With a simple design, traders of all experience levels can quickly identify and perform trades, anytime, anywhere. A simple and responsive layout ensures more time engaged with the interface and higher user satisfaction.
-
24/7 Entry to Market Access
The forex platform will maintain an open market, as is typical of the forex market. Users will be enabled to enter their accounts and perform trades around the clock, as is common in a 24/7 market environment.
Tech Stack We Used to Build a Forex Trading Script
Frontend: Frontend technologies (like React.js, Angular, or Vue.js) provide a responsive, dynamic interface with quick loading times and the ability to take input across all devices.
Backend: These technologies (Node.js, Python (Django), and PHP (Laravel)) create the backend for the core trading engine that reliably processes the data for trade execution and communication between the trading server.
Database: Technologies such as PostgreSQL or MongoDB can reliably and securely manage your data, storing user information, trading information, and analytics to enhance performance and usability with real-time access.
API Integration: We have developed and integrated APIs using RESTful and WebSocket protocols, allowing access to liquidity, real-time market data, and third-party exchanges, ensuring our exchanges seamlessly synchronize global markets in real time.
Blockchain Integration (Optional): While optional, blockchain offers the ability to transparently and securely record transactions in a decentralized way to build trust and mitigate the risk of manipulation.
Security Features in a Forex Trading Script
Two-Factor Authentication (2FA): A secondary verification method for your login or withdrawal. We ensure that only verified users may authenticate their access and, if sensitive. Transfer funds away from your account.
SSL Encryption: SSL certification secures all data transmitted between users and servers via encryption, denoting whether it is intercepted to the extent possible, and secures your private information from external threats.
Anti-DDoS Protection: To mitigate potential downtime caused by distributed denial-of-service attacks, this system is secured against disruption from malicious attackers. Working as desired, this protection keeps trading operations transparent and your order flow uninterrupted through spikes in traffic.
KYC/AML Verification: All the verification tools required to ensure that traders are compliant with the Know Your Customer (KYC) and Anti-Money Laundering (AML) rules, and avoid the risk of fraud and other legal implications of trading.
Cold Wallet Storage (for crypto-based forex): For hybrid forex brokers that allow for the trading of crypto assets, those crypto assets typically reside in cold wallets to mitigate the risk of online threats or hackers.
Popular Forex Trading Platforms on the Market
MetaTrader 4 (MT4): MetaTrader 4 or MT4 is probably one of the most accessed trading platforms in the forex space. With an easy user interface, technical indicators, and the ability to automate trading through the use of Expert Advisors (EAs) allows traders from all backgrounds to be served.
MetaTrader 5 (MT5): MetaTrader 5, or MT5, is the subsequent version of MT4. This platform is multi-asset based, with advanced charting and fast order processing. It is used by professional traders who want to have access to as many markets as possible.
cTrader: cTrader is another commonly used trading platform, liked and trusted by many brokers because of the openness and accuracy of the data it displays. Traders can access Glut charting tools, advanced order types, and have access to multiple liquidity providers.
NinjaTrader: This platform can be used for both futures and forex-based market trading and is most often assigned to detailed analytic work and backtesting, allowing traders to establish and amend their trading strategies quickly and effectively.
Why Choose AppcloneX’s Forex Clone Script?
The Forex Clone Script from AppcloneX Solutions has been developed for high reliability, performance, and customizability. It enables a complete forex trading platform of any scope, and is feature-rich and in line with global forex industry standards, while providing you with total brand control and revenue.
Our exchange script has multi-asset trading functionality, real-time data tracking, AI-powered trade bots, and liquidity options, thus ensuring an uninterrupted trading experience for both traders and brokerage firms. Also, the app is fully customizable, allowing platform UX to be easily designed and updated, new trading pairs to be added, and payment mechanisms to be integrated smoothly.
AppcloneX also fulfills end-to-end support, from the initial setup groundwork through maintenance, to ensure the continued operation of your platform 24/7. Our firm has a long history in fintech software development, so you can be secure in knowing your platform is being developed in a future-proof manner.
Ready to launch your own forex trading platform?
Contact AppcloneX to access a free demo of our Forex Trading Script, and let us provide you with guidance about our methods for developing your successful forex business.